Why ISI Certification is Crucial for Consumer Safety in India ?
Consumers in India are
becoming increasingly safety-conscious. From electrical appliances to
construction materials, they want assurance that the products they buy won’t
pose risks. This assurance is provided through ISI Certification—a
system designed to protect both consumers and manufacturers.
What is ISI Certification?
ISI Certification is the process by which
the Bureau of Indian Standards (BIS) tests and validates that a product meets
the relevant Indian Standards. Once approved, manufacturers are granted the ISI
Mark License.
How ISI Certification Protects Consumers
- Ensures Product Safety
Products undergo rigorous lab testing to eliminate safety risks. - Reduces Risk of
Accidents
Certified appliances, helmets, and pipes significantly reduce chances of injury or damage. - Guarantees Quality
Consistency
Ongoing inspections make sure each batch meets the same standards. - Protects Against
Counterfeits
Consumers can identify genuine products with the ISI Mark.
Industries Where Safety Matters Most
- Electrical Goods: Preventing short
circuits and fires.
- Construction
Materials: Ensuring durability and structural safety.
- Toys: Protecting children
from harmful chemicals.
- Safety Equipment: Helmets, eyewear, and
more.
Consumer Perspective
When buyers see an ISI
Mark, they feel secure. They know the product has passed government-approved
quality checks. This trust directly influences purchasing decisions.
